Output 621433c557bde1f725c0a7eb1708a8218c9dad68aa571a3bb29ce4c41e9f6017:0

value
158070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4362c4c24b979ba5cbd6d5def54ca242957cada5 OP_EQUAL
address
37qKWxY2Bau1G3ZgHXfK4ynEtGoKBoJKya
transaction
621433c557bde1f725c0a7eb1708a8218c9dad68aa571a3bb29ce4c41e9f6017
confirmations
276361
spent
true